**the Simple Things

The grasp of your hand
The twinkle in your eye
The things I love the most
Money could never buy

The smile in your voice
The tenderness of your touch
I’m not that hard to please
I don’t ask for much

The warmth inside your soul
The beating of your heart
It’s the way you treat me
That sets you apart

The love that we share
And all the joys it brings
What I enjoy most
Are all the simple things
